It feels wrong to pull perfectly good young fruit off a tree and drop it on the ground, but thinning is one of the highest-payback things you can do in a backyard orchard. A tree left to ripen everything it sets produces a heavy crop of small, mediocre fruit—and often breaks limbs doing it. A thinned tree channels the same energy into fewer fruit, so each one grows bigger, colors better, and tastes sweeter. Thinning also reduces limb breakage, curbs the boom-and-bust “biennial bearing” cycle, and limits the spread of pests and rot. Why Thinning Produces Bigger, Better Fruit
A fruit tree has a finite budget of sugars, water, and minerals to spend in a season. When it sets hundreds of fruit, that budget gets divided into hundreds of tiny shares—so you get many small fruit. Remove half of them and each survivor inherits a larger share, sizing up dramatically. The relationship isn’t linear: cutting fruit count by a third often more than doubles individual fruit size, because final size depends on how many cells each fruit can build and how much it can swell. Larger fruit also concentrates more sugar, so flavor improves alongside size.
There are three other big reasons to thin. First, limb protection: a branch loaded end-to-end with apples can snap or bend permanently, and a torn limb is an open wound for disease. Second, biennial bearing: trees that overcrop one year exhaust themselves setting next year’s flower buds, so they crop heavily one season and barely at all the next. Thinning to a moderate load every year smooths this into steady annual harvests. Third, pest and disease control: touching fruit in a tight cluster lets coddling moth larvae, brown rot, and earwigs move fruit-to-fruit. Spacing fruit out breaks those bridges.
When to Thin
Timing matters more than most people realize, because fruit size is largely locked in by how early you thin. Aim to thin while fruit is still small—dime to nickel diameter, roughly 1/2 to 1 inch—which for most temperate fruit lands 2 to 4 weeks after petal fall (full bloom). In much of the US that’s late May through June.
Many trees do some self-thinning in the so-called June drop, naturally shedding excess fruit a few weeks after bloom. Don’t rely on it—it rarely removes enough. The ideal strategy is to wait until just after June drop so you can see which fruit the tree has already aborted, then hand-thin the rest to your target spacing. Thinning earlier (right after petal fall) gives the biggest size response and the strongest effect on next year’s flower bud set, so if you must choose, lean early. Thinning late—after fruit is golf-ball size or larger—still helps with limb load but gives much less size benefit because the tree has already committed energy.
How Far Apart to Space Fruit, by Type
Spacing is the heart of the job. Fruit on the same spur or cluster competes most fiercely, so the general rule is one fruit per cluster, then a set distance between the fruit you keep along the branch.
- Apples: Reduce each cluster (usually 4–6 flowers) to the single largest “king” fruit, then thin so remaining apples are 6–8 inches apart.
- Pears: Similar to apples—one fruit per cluster, 6–8 inches apart. European pears can carry a touch more than apples.
- Peaches and nectarines: The biggest beneficiaries. Thin to 4–6 inches apart (some growers go to 8 in for show-size fruit). Peaches set heavily and produce notably small fruit if left unthinned.
- Apricots: Thin to 2–4 inches apart.
- Plums: Japanese plums benefit from thinning to 3–4 inches; European/prune plums usually need little.
- Cherries, figs, persimmons, most citrus: Generally need no thinning—they self-regulate or carry small fruit fine.
When you can’t reach exact numbers, use the “hand-width” shortcut: leave roughly one apple per spread hand along a branch, one peach every four fingers. It’s faster than measuring and close enough.
How to Thin: Technique
For soft, small fruit you can thin by hand. Hold the branch steady with one hand so you don’t strip leaves or knock off keepers, and twist or snap the unwanted fruit off with the other, or pinch through the stem with your thumbnail. For peaches, some gardeners use the “strike” method on large trees—gently tapping branches with a padded pole to knock off loosely attached fruit—but hand-thinning gives precise spacing. Always remove first: damaged, undersized, insect-stung, or doubled fruit, and any growing in a tight cluster. Keep the largest, best-positioned fruit, ideally one hanging where it won’t rub a branch.
Pick up and remove the thinned fruit from under the tree rather than leaving it to rot, since dropped fruit harbors pests and disease that carry into next season. Cluster Thinning vs. Spacing
It helps to think of thinning in two stages. The first is cluster thinning: most apples and pears bloom in clusters of four to six flowers, and if every one sets, you get a dense knot of fruit that shades and crowds itself. Reduce each cluster to its single best fruit—usually the central “king” bloom, which sets first and grows largest. The second stage is spacing thinning: once clusters are reduced to one fruit each, step back and look at the whole branch, then remove additional single fruit so the keepers sit at the recommended distance apart. Doing both gives far better results than either alone. A branch that has been cluster-thinned but not spaced still carries too many fruit overall; one that’s spaced but left with full clusters wastes energy on competition within each knot.
Chemical and Bloom Thinning (Briefly)
Commercial apple growers often thin chemically—spraying at bloom or shortly after to cause excess fruit to drop—because hand-thinning thousands of trees isn’t feasible. For a backyard grower this is rarely worth the precision and risk; the products are sensitive to timing, weather, and variety, and a mistake can strip the whole crop. Hand-thinning a few trees is more accurate, more satisfying, and carries no chance of an over-thinning disaster. One low-tech “bloom thinning” trick that is homeowner-friendly: on alternate-bearing apples in a heavy “on” year, rub off a portion of the flower buds or blossoms early to lighten the load before fruit even sets, which conserves the tree’s energy for next year’s flower buds and helps break the biennial cycle.
Don’t Over-Thin
It is possible to remove too much. Leave enough fruit to use the tree’s capacity—over-thinning wastes potential harvest and can even cause some fruit to grow oversized and split. Stick to the spacing guidelines; they already build in a generous size margin. A mature semi-dwarf apple comfortably ripens 100–200 good apples, so you are reducing a glut, not gutting the crop.
Thinning and Tree Health Over Time
The long game is steady annual cropping and a structurally sound tree. By thinning every year you keep the tree from the exhaustion that triggers alternate bearing, and you protect scaffold limbs from the slow sag and splitting that overloaded branches develop. Young trees especially should be thinned hard—or stripped entirely in their first fruiting year—so they invest in roots and framework rather than a premature heavy crop. Combined with good watering during fruit sizing (1–2 in per week) and the right rootstock for your space, thinning is what separates a backyard tree that produces tiny annual gluts from one that delivers reliable, dessert-quality fruit.
